Saudi Arabia offers a diverse range of accommodations to cater to various preferences and needs. You can find luxury hotels, which are often equipped with world-class amenities, including spas, fine dining, and concierge services. For travelers seeking a more budget-friendly experience, there are countless mid-range hotels and hostels that provide comfortable stays with essential services. Additionally, unique options such as traditional guesthouses and cultural accommodations allow visitors to engage more authentically with local culture. Furthermore, during the Hajj pilgrimage season, there are various accommodation options near holy sites tailored specifically for pilgrims.
Hotels in Saudi Arabia generally offer a wide range of amenities designed to enhance the comfort and experience of guests. Most establishments provide essentials such as free Wi-Fi, air conditioning, and room service. Many hotels also feature pools, fitness centers, and on-site restaurants, catering to both local and international cuisines. In luxury hotels, you might find additional services such as spa treatments, business centers, and concierge services to assist with travel arrangements or local recommendations. It’s common for hotels to include prayer facilities, reflecting the cultural significance of faith in the country.

Family stays are widely welcomed in hotels across Saudi Arabia, with many establishments offering family-friendly amenities and policies. Family rooms or suites are typically available, allowing for comfortable accommodations for parents traveling with children. Many hotels provide amenities such as cribs, extra bedding, and even children's menus in their restaurants. Some larger hotels and resorts feature recreational facilities such as kids' clubs or designated play areas, ensuring entertainment for younger guests. When booking, it’s advisable for families to inquire about specific policies related to children, such as age restrictions or any associated fees.
When staying in hotels in Saudi Arabia, it is essential to be mindful of the local customs and cultural norms. Saudi Arabia observes Islamic traditions, which influence various aspects of daily life, including dress codes and behaviors. It is generally advisable to wear modest clothing in public areas. Additionally, while hotels are typically accommodating to international guests, it’s important to respect local customs, such as refraining from public displays of affection. Alcohol consumption is prohibited throughout the country, including in hotels. Being aware of prayer times and hotel policies regarding children during these times can also enhance your visit.
